Understanding the Imperial Playstyle

Before we dive into specific lists, let's talk about what makes the Empire tick in Star Wars: Legion. The Galactic Empire, at its core, is about overwhelming force, disciplined firepower, and controlling the battlefield. They excel at suppressing the enemy with relentless shooting, utilizing powerful special forces to eliminate key threats, and leveraging command abilities to coordinate devastating attacks.

  • Firepower is Key: Imperial armies generally want to bring the pain with ranged attacks. Weapons like the DLT-19, RT-97C, and various heavy weapons upgrades are your friends. The Empire has many ways to ensure this such as the Aggressive Tactics of Darth Vader or the Coordinate Fire ability given to Imperial officers.
  • Discipline and Morale: While not immune to suppression, the Empire has tools to mitigate its effects, ensuring your troopers stay in the fight. Consider units with abilities like Courage and Inspire or command cards that remove suppression tokens.
  • Elite Units: The Empire boasts some of the most fearsome special forces in the game, such as Death Troopers and Scout Troopers. Utilize these units to flank the enemy, disrupt their plans, and eliminate high-value targets.
  • Command and Control: Imperial commanders like Darth Vader, Emperor Palpatine, and Director Krennic offer powerful command abilities that can swing the tide of battle. Knowing when and how to use these abilities is crucial for success. The ability to coordinate fire and suppress enemies will come in handy.

Essential Imperial Units for 2023

To construct a winning list, you need to know the must-have units in the Imperial arsenal. These are the units that consistently perform well and provide the foundation for many competitive lists. Think of these as the bread and butter of your Imperial war machine.

  • Darth Vader: The Dark Lord of the Sith is an absolute beast on the battlefield. His raw power, combined with his command abilities, makes him a force to be reckoned with. Vader can single-handedly turn the tide of battle, especially when equipped with upgrades like Force Reflexes and Saber Throw.
  • Imperial Death Troopers: These elite special forces are masters of infiltration and assassination. With their high damage output and access to powerful weapons like the DLT-19D, Death Troopers can eliminate key enemy units with frightening efficiency. Coordinate these with a unit such as Orson Krennic to make a deadly combo that will change the very flow of battle on the tabletop.
  • Shoretroopers: These specialized troopers are the backbone of many Imperial armies. Their superior firepower and resilience make them excellent objective holders and damage dealers. Equip them with the T-21B targeting rifle for even greater effectiveness. The Shore Troopers are vital if you plan to hold any ground for a protracted length of time.
  • E-Web Heavy Blaster Team: A staple of Imperial firepower, the E-Web can lay down a withering barrage of fire that will suppress and eliminate enemy units. Position it carefully to maximize its range and line of sight. The ability to suppress enemies is one of the best the Empire has to offer.
  • AT-ST: The All Terrain Scout Transport provides heavy fire support and a significant psychological advantage. With its powerful weapons and durable armor, the AT-ST can dominate the battlefield. Remember to keep it supported by other units to prevent it from being flanked. The AT-ST is a terror to behold.

Powerful Imperial List Archetypes for 2023

Now that we've covered the essential units, let's explore some powerful list archetypes that you can use as a starting point for your own creations. These archetypes represent different approaches to building and playing Imperial armies, each with its own strengths and weaknesses. The key is to understand these archetypes and adapt them to your own preferences and playstyle.

1. Vader Hammer

This list focuses on using Darth Vader as a central offensive threat, supported by units that can provide fire support and protect him from enemy fire.

  • Core Units: Darth Vader, Shoretroopers, E-Web Heavy Blaster Team, Imperial Officer
  • Strategy: Use Vader to aggressively push towards the enemy, while the Shoretroopers and E-Web provide covering fire. The Imperial Officer provides crucial command support. The goal of this archetype is to put the opponent on the back foot and force them to react to Vader's presence.
  • Strengths: High damage output, strong melee threat, good command and control.
  • Weaknesses: Vulnerable to long-range fire, susceptible to disruption tactics.

2. Death Trooper Strike Force

This list revolves around using Death Troopers as the primary offensive force, supported by other elite units and command assets.

  • Core Units: Imperial Death Troopers, Director Orson Krennic, Scout Troopers, DT-LT242
  • Strategy: Use Krennic to buff the Death Troopers and coordinate their attacks. Scout Troopers provide flanking support and disrupt the enemy's plans. The DT-LT242 gives you the ability to take accurate long range shots.
  • Strengths: Excellent at eliminating high-value targets, strong flanking potential, good command and control.
  • Weaknesses: Relatively fragile, vulnerable to heavy fire, susceptible to disruption tactics.

3. Armor Column

This list utilizes the AT-ST as the primary offensive force, supported by infantry units that can provide screening and objective control.

  • Core Units: AT-ST, Shoretroopers, Imperial Officer, Stormtroopers
  • Strategy: Use the AT-ST to dominate the battlefield with its heavy firepower, while the Shoretroopers and Stormtroopers secure objectives and screen the AT-ST from enemy attacks. The Imperial Officer provides command support and ensures the army stays coordinated. This is where the Empire gets to shine when it comes to a combined arms approach to Star Wars: Legion.
  • Strengths: High durability, excellent firepower, good objective control.
  • Weaknesses: Slow moving, vulnerable to close combat, susceptible to disruption tactics.

4. Palpatine's Puppets

This list focuses on using Emperor Palpatine's command abilities to manipulate the battlefield and control the flow of the game.

  • Core Units: Emperor Palpatine, Royal Guard, Shoretroopers, Imperial Officer
  • Strategy: Use Palpatine's command cards to disrupt the enemy's plans and set up favorable engagements. The Royal Guard provide a strong defensive screen for Palpatine, while the Shoretroopers secure objectives and provide fire support. The Imperial Officer provides additional command support. Be prepared to use Palpatine's Pulling the Strings ability at a key moment.
  • Strengths: Excellent command and control, strong defensive capabilities, good objective control.
  • Weaknesses: Relatively slow moving, vulnerable to long-range fire, susceptible to disruption tactics.

Tips and Tricks for Imperial Commanders

Here are some essential tips and tricks to help you succeed with your Imperial armies in Star Wars: Legion:

  • Master the Art of Suppression: The Empire excels at suppressing the enemy with relentless fire. Use weapons like the DLT-19 and E-Web to pin down enemy units and prevent them from taking actions.
  • Utilize Cover Effectively: Imperial units are generally more durable than their Rebel counterparts, but they are still vulnerable to fire. Use cover to your advantage to minimize casualties and maximize your units' survivability.
  • Coordinate Your Attacks: Imperial armies are most effective when they are working together in a coordinated manner. Use command cards and abilities to synchronize your attacks and maximize your damage output.
  • Adapt to the Battlefield: Every game of Star Wars: Legion is different. Be prepared to adapt your strategy and tactics based on the terrain, objectives, and your opponent's list.
